Sounds like you want to join two rings with the plane of each ring at

90 degrees. You want one ring to have it's outside diameter the same size as the inside diameter of the second ring. You would then put the smaller inside the larger and solder such that you get the 90 degree plane.

If you end up making your own, would you create a nicer looking ring cage by having both rings the same diameter and cutting the second ring in half and soldering both halves to the first ring.

Not sure how hard my suggestion would be since I have never done this type of soldering. Sounds interesting though.
